When is the best season for tree trimming?

The best season for trimming actually depends on the sort of tree and also the region you live in. As a whole, it's ideal to have a tree trimmer cut your trees while they are dormant.

Winter tree maintenance is good due to the fact that the remainder of your backyard and landscape need minimal care at that time. Cutting back trees just before fresh springtime growth emerges places lower stress on trees, and can help with hearty growth through the springtime and summer months.

It's still perfectly fine to cut back, thin as well as shape trees in the spring and summer months also, particularly if there is any type of dead wood, disease, or overgrowth.

Palm Tree Trimming

One needs to be cautious when caring for palm trees. Clipping them incorrectly or when the leaves are green can leave them susceptible to diseases as well as bugs. Palm trees should be trimmed when the oldest fronds on the tree have actually died and turned completely dry. This is normally one or two times per year.

Annual upkeep will help keep trees healthy, and protect against accidents and injuries from dropping fronds.

Pine Tree Trimming

The very best time for pine tree cutting is in the early spring, though if you find dead or diseased branches, it's best to have those cut back to avoid issues from spreading.

It is essential to use correct trimming methods. Cutting back branches to shorten them, is not a good plan. It can cease the growth of the branch entirely and cause it to appear stunted.

Pinching back new growth tips in the spring can help give pine trees an eye-catching thick and compact growth shape.
